Kerala’s power crisis has intensified, with Chief Minister V D Satheesan setting September 15 as the target for relief measures, according to a report by Deccan Herald.

The state is facing growing pressure on its power supply, raising concerns over the availability and management of electricity during a period of rising demand.
The government is expected to focus on measures to ease the immediate shortage while working towards a more sustainable solution for Kerala’s power requirements.
The September 15 target comes as the state seeks to address the challenges affecting power availability and ensure a more stable electricity supply.
The developments also highlight the need to strengthen Kerala’s power infrastructure and improve long-term planning as electricity demand continues to rise.
